You might be able to get a three bedroom at that price (lower, really) in the Tin Liu village apartments on Ma Wan (Park Island). There are shuttle buses to Tsing Yi and Kwai Fong, both of which can easily get you to Kowloon.

zbm - Our flat is a little more then 14,000, but if you go a bit smaller and negotiate you could probably get something for 14,000 or less. It is a 3 storey walk-up which helped us negotiate. For the size and the location we are really happy we found it. The interior has been completely redone so it feels clean, spacious and open. The exterior is old, but again that lends to the decreased price.

If you're looking to be closer to the Central Business District Areas as well as having a reasonable commute to work. Then consider Jordan/Yau Ma Tei aorund Ferry Street and Man Ying Street, Hillwood Rd in TST and Austin Rd/Austin Avenue area as well - all have direct buses to Kwun Tong and are accessible to the MTR too!
The buildings are older but more spacious.
